In a disturbing development, cybercriminals have been spotted stitching together
strands of code extracted from various malware strains to develop their “own”
derivatives.

After creating the digital equivalent of Frankenstein’s monster, perpetrators
attempted to spread their unholy creation by dropping it into legitimate hubs
such as PyPI, GitHub, RubyGems and NPM.
